- add ``ansible_user`` to ``group_vars`` by default
- add fetch and checkout of roles during update. this enables branch or tag changing
- add persist command to run ``inventory_writers``
- no longer run ``inventory_writers`` on update and init commands
- fix handling of added files from inventory plugins
- add ``deployment.key`` to deployment repo and inventory